The Master of Science in Architectural Sciences and the Master of Science in Lighting degree programs offer non-professional non-terminal research degrees in a variety of concentrations that culminate in a thesis or research project. There are two distinct arrangements: the one-year Master of Science in Architectural Sciences 30 credit-hour program is tailored for students who are interested in pursuing the PhD degree but who have not yet acquired the skills or knowledge to move directly into the program. It also serves those who are looking for qualifications in architectural research, university teaching or specialized practices. They are in the fields of Architectural Acoustics, Built Ecologies, and Lighting.
 
The Master of Science in Lighting degree is a two-year program and is shaped to specific objectives.
